Subject: Insurance Renewal — Quick Heads-Up

Team, our cover with Bellwater Mutual renews at the end of next month. Premiums are up about 9%, mostly on the cyber line. Freya is getting two alternative quotes before we commit. Heads of department, please flag any new assets or risks by Friday. The wider context is in the confidential note below.

confidential, fahip-bagep: The southern region missed its Holwyn quota by 21.5 percent last quarter. Sorvanek Foods plans to raise the Jorir list price by 23.9 percent in December. The pricing group signed off on a budget of $411.6 million for Project Eliion. The renewal with Juldorix Works closes at $87.9 million a year, 16.8 percent below the last contract.

Hi Tobin,

Handing off the intermittent DNS failures affecting the Harborline checkout service. Lookups against the internal resolver time out roughly every forty minutes, then recover. I've captured traces in the incident doc and raised a ticket with the Netfabric team. Please warn support about possible checkout errors. For updates, the network on-call can be reached below.

escalation mailbox, fafof-bahip: tamael@ordincorp.test

Q: What's the status of the Farepoint ticket-pricing experiment?

A: The experiment on the Glimmerline booking flow is at 20% traffic, split across three price tiers. Early numbers show conversion up 4% on tier B with no significant refund increase. Tier C is underperforming and will likely be cut Friday. Guardrail metrics (checkout latency, abandonment) are within bounds. Do not ship pricing changes to the control cohort during the run. Analysis lands at next week's sync. Questions or anomaly reports go to the experiments owner.

alerts address for fafop-tajog: keleth.joreth.fravan@qorvelhq.corp